Transponder Codes

Like its name suggests, transponders send out an encoded signal that contains a four-digit number code when it is being questioned by air traffic control. This signal, referred to as SQUAWK Code SQUAWK Code is used to identify aircraft on radar screens. It also serves to transmit a specific message to air traffic control in the case of an emergency or to alert air traffic controllers to changes in weather conditions. Squawk codes are commonly utilized to communicate with ATC in situations where pilots are unable to communicate via radio. They are crucial for safe flying.

Every aircraft is equipped with a transponder that responds to radar probes by identifying a code. This enables ATC to locate an aircraft in a crowd of screens. Transponders have several different modes that differ in how they respond to interrogation. Mode A only transmits the code, whereas mode C also contains altitude information. Mode S transponders send more specific information, including callsigns and positions. This is useful when flying in airspace with a lot of people.

A common sight is a small brown box under the seat of a pilot in most aircraft. It is a transponder, and it is designed to transmit the SQUAWK code when the airplane is activated by air traffic control. The transponder may be set to the 'ON' the ALT, or the SBY (standby position) positions.

It is common to hear a pilot being told by air traffic control to "squawk ident". This is a directive for the pilots to press their transponder IDENT button. The button causes the aircraft to blink on the ATC's radar screens and allows the pilot to easily recognize your aircraft on the screen.

PIN Codes

A PIN code consists of a sequence of numbers (usually 4 or 6 digits), which are used to gain access to a device, service, or system. For instance, a smartphone phone has a PIN code that is set by the user when they first purchase the device. The user must enter this code each time they want to use it. PIN codes are also commonly used to protect ATM or POS transactions,[1] secure access control (doors, computers, cars),[2] computer systems,[3and online transactions.

VIN Numbers

VIN numbers are used to identify vehicles and provide a wealth of information about them.  car key cut and program  are unique to every vehicle on earth and are not applicable to alien vehicles (or whatever). The 17 numbers of a VIN code are a mixture of letters and numbers which can be decoded to reveal vital information about your car or truck.

Modern automobiles contain a tremendous amount of information regarding their history and features they act as digital libraries that are mobile. A VIN number is the key that unlocks this information, allowing you to learn everything from whether your car is in a recall to the number of times it's changed owners.

A VIN number is comprised of different sections, each with particular information. The first digit, for instance indicates the kind of vehicle the car is, such as an automobile for passengers, a pickup truck or SUV. The second digit is the manufacturer. The third digit is the car's assembly division, and the fourth through eighth numbers describe the model type, the type of restraint system and body type as well as engine and transmission codes. The ninth number is the check digit, which prevents fraud by confirming that the VIN number isn't altered.



In North America, the 10th through 17th digits of the VIN code are referred to as the Vehicle Identification Section, or VIS. The tenth digit indicates the year of the vehicle's production, and the eleventh digit indicates which assembly plant produced the vehicle. A key programmer is a tool that enables a technician or even someone with basic skills, to program a transponder. This is a relatively simple procedure that involves connecting the tool to the OBD II port on the vehicle, and using it to pull the programming information from the computer. The tool will then recode the transponder in order to match the code stored in the program which will allow the key to start and operate the vehicle.
